DESCRIPTION

IEEE/ANSI N42.55-2013



The purpose of this standard is to establish requirements and methods of test for portable transmission x-ray systems for use in improvised explosive device and hazardous device disarming and render safe operations. These systems include those that provide still and/or video images. This standard does not apply to cabinet x-ray systems, such as those used for security screening, and backscatter x-ray systems.
